The rise of accredited online NP programs has democratized advanced nursing education. These programs are designed to provide the same high-quality curriculum as their on-campus counterparts, delivered through a dynamic blend of asynchronous and synchronous learning. Students can access lectures, course materials, and discussions at their convenience, allowing them to balance their studies with personal and professional commitments. This flexibility is particularly beneficial for working RNs who wish to continue gaining clinical experience while earning their degree. The core components of an online NP program typically include advanced pathophysiology, pharmacology, health assessment, and specialized courses in a chosen population focus, such as Family, Psychiatric-Mental Health, Adult-Gerontology, or Pediatrics.
Choosing the right online NP school requires careful consideration of several critical factors to ensure the program aligns with your career goals and learning style.
- Accreditation: This is the most crucial factor. Ensure the program is accredited by either the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) or the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N). Graduating from an accredited program is mandatory for obtaining certification and state licensure.
- Specialization Tracks: Identify programs that offer the specific patient population focus you are passionate about, such as Family Nurse Practitioner (FNP) or Adult-Gerontology Acute Care Nurse Practitioner (AGACNP).
- Clinical Placement Support: Inquire about the school’s role in securing clinical preceptors and sites. Some programs offer substantial assistance, while others require students to find their own placements, which can be a significant challenge.
- Faculty Expertise: Research the qualifications and experience of the faculty. Learning from practicing NPs and experts in the field enriches the educational experience.
- Student Support Services: Robust online libraries, tutoring, technical support, and career services are essential for success in a virtual learning environment.
While the flexibility of online NP school is a major advantage, it comes with its own set of challenges that require proactive management.
- Self-Discipline and Time Management: Success hinges on your ability to create and stick to a structured study schedule. Treat your online coursework like a job with set hours.
- Technology Requirements: A reliable computer, high-speed internet connection, and basic tech proficiency are non-negotiable for participating in lectures, submitting assignments, and taking exams.
- Building a Community: Actively engage with peers and instructors through discussion forums, virtual study groups, and online networking events to combat feelings of isolation.
- Clinical Hours: Balancing required clinical hours with work and family life demands meticulous planning and communication with your clinical preceptor and employer.
The financial investment in an online NP program is substantial, but numerous options can help mitigate the cost. Tuition varies widely between institutions, so it’s essential to get a clear understanding of the total cost per credit hour and any additional fees. Many students utilize a combination of federal financial aid (loans and grants), scholarships from nursing associations and foundations, employer tuition reimbursement programs, and military benefits. The return on investment, however, is significant. Nurse Practitioners are among the highest-paid nursing professionals, and the career offers immense job security and opportunities for growth.
Upon graduation from an accredited online NP program, you must take the final steps to practice. This involves passing a national certification exam administered by an organization like the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C) or the American Association of Nurse Practitioners (AANP). Certification is specific to your population focus. Once certified, you must apply for state licensure as an Advanced Practice Registered Nurse (APRN). Each state has its own Board of Nursing with specific requirements for practice authority, which can range from full practice to reduced or restricted practice, impacting your ability to work independently.
